What is Mailgun?

Mailgun is a transactional email API service developed by Mailgun (company) that enables developers and businesses to send, receive, track, and optimize emails. It provides tools focusing on deliverability and validation, offering developer-friendly APIs for integration into applications. The service supports sending, receiving, and tracking emails at scale via API and SMTP, and includes features like email validation, inbox placement testing, and blocklist monitoring. Mailgun also offers an Email Template Builder, flexible data routing, and an AI-powered Virtual Email Assistant for support, alongside send-time optimization to enhance email performance.

How to Use Mailgun

To begin using Mailgun, developers typically integrate its API or SMTP services into their applications. The process involves setting up a Mailgun account, configuring domains, and utilizing the provided SDKs or direct API calls for email operations.

  • 1Sign up for a Mailgun account on their official website.
  • 2Add and verify your sending domain within the Mailgun control panel.
  • 3Integrate the Mailgun API into your application using available SDKs (e.g., Python, Ruby, PHP, Java) or direct HTTP requests.
  • 4Configure DNS records (SPF, DKIM, DMARC) for your domain to ensure email authentication and deliverability.
  • 5Utilize the API or SMTP to send transactional emails, marketing campaigns, or process inbound emails.
  • 6Monitor email logs, analytics, and deliverability reports through the Mailgun dashboard to optimize performance.

Pros

  • +Reliable email delivery with high uptime (100% uptime noted by users).
  • +Robust and developer-friendly API for seamless integration into applications.
  • +Comprehensive suite of deliverability tools, including email validation and inbox placement testing.
  • +Detailed analytics and logs for effective debugging and performance monitoring.
  • +Strong inbound email parsing and routing capabilities.
  • +Scalable for both small businesses and large enterprises.
  • +User-friendly UI/UX for managing email campaigns and settings.

Cons

  • Pricing can escalate quickly with increased email usage, potentially impacting smaller businesses.
  • The user dashboard and log viewer have been noted by some users as occasionally slow.
  • Initial setup and API integration for sending to multiple recipients can present a learning curve.
  • May require more technical expertise compared to platforms with simpler, more marketing-focused UIs.
  • Some users report that the cost per 1,000 emails can be higher than very low-cost alternatives like Amazon SES.
